How can I fix the greyed out "Insert Link" icon in Webflow?

To fix the issue of the greyed out "Insert Link" icon in Webflow, you can follow these steps:

  1. Select the element: Move your cursor over the element that you want to insert a link into. This could be a text element, an image, or any other element that supports linking.

  2. Enable the link settings: On the right-hand side of the Webflow editor, you will see the element's settings panel. It is usually indicated by a cog icon. Click on it to open the settings panel.

  3. Navigate to the Link settings: Within the settings panel, there should be a section specifically for handling links. It may be named "Link" or "Link settings". Click on it to open the link settings.

  4. Check the element type: Ensure that the element you selected for the link supports adding a link. For example, a div block doesn't support links, but a text element or an image does. If the element you selected doesn't support links, you may need to choose a different type of element.

  5. Verify the link interaction: If you are utilizing interactions on the element, it's essential to confirm that the link interaction isn't conflicting with the link settings. Check if any interactions are disabling the link or altering its behavior.

  6. Confirm the element isn't locked: Sometimes, elements can be locked accidentally, preventing any changes or interactions from being applied. Make sure the element you're working with is not locked. If it is, unlock it by selecting the element and clicking on the lock icon in the top toolbar.

  7. Clear cache and reload: If you've followed all the steps and the "Insert Link" icon is still greyed out, clear your browser cache and reload the Webflow editor. Sometimes, cache issues can cause temporary glitches, and clearing the cache can resolve them.

  8. Try a different browser or device: If the issue still persists, try accessing Webflow from a different browser or device. This will help determine if it's a browser-specific issue or if it's related to the website itself.

By following these steps, you should be able to fix the greyed out "Insert Link" icon in Webflow and insert links as intended.
